Two new radio stations start broadcasting on digital radio in Kyiv
15.08.2024 - Ukraine Ukraine
DJ FM and POWER FM have joined the Kyiv DAB+ multiplex, which already brings together a number of popular radio stations. According to the industry community Telecom Circle, the new participants have joined the digital multiplex on channel 11D, marking the next stage in the development of digital radio broadcasting in Ukraine. The following radio stations are currently available in the Kyiv DAB+ multiplex: ARMY FM, DJ FM, POWER FM, PRIYAMIY FM, Prosto Radio, PROSTO MARIA, UA:RADIO PROMIN, UA:RADIO KULTURE and UKRAINSKE RADIO. The expansion of the digital broadcasting network is an important step in the development of the Ukrainian radio space, which helps to improve the quality of broadcasting and expand the audience.

Teleko to launch new DAB+ transmitters, Strážník, Brno and Velká Javorina to come
15.08.2024 - Czechia Czechia
Teleko digital, a company from Příbram, is planning a massive expansion of its radio network in the eastern part of the country. The company's managing director Tomáš Řapek confirmed this to the Digital Radio portal. By the end of August, the operator will launch the final transmitter in Vysočina, which will replace the existing channel 8A and other locations will follow. The most anticipated one is undoubtedly Velka Javorina located in Slovakia. The Strážník transmitter in Vysočina will be the next site on the final technical parameters granted by the Czech Telecommunications Office, following the Moravian-Silesian Lysá hora. At Strážník, channel 8A with a power of 1 kW will be switched off and re-tuned to frequency block 10D, which has been granted 5 kW by the CTU.

Studio Gong markets the New Audio Kombi NRW
15.08.2024 - Germany Germany
STUDIO GONG launches a state-wide marketing combination for the federal state of North Rhine-Westphalia. The NEW AUDIO KOMBI NRW comprises nine programmes, each of which can be received throughout the state via DAB+. The combined members are the 80s radio station harmony, bigFM NRW, ENERGY NRW, kulthitRADIO in NRW, Radio Paloma, Radio Paradiso, Radio Holiday, Schlager Radio and the most recently launched station STAR.FM NRW. All stations have a high technical reach and are broadcast via the state-wide DAB+ multiplex in NRW. Changing markets and user habits are creating new challenges for the media. For this reason, the Kombi covers all sections of the population with its different formats, from rock to pop to youth formats, and reaches new listeners in the middle of society in every relevant target group that the established programmes do not or no longer reach.

Akos allocates radio frequencies for DAB+ networks R4 and R5 to RTV Slovenia
14.08.2024 - RTV Slovenija WorldDAB Member - Slovenia Slovenia
The Agency for Communications Networks and Services (Akos) has issued Radio Slovenia with decisions on the allocation of radio frequencies for the R4 and R5 multiplexes, i.e. the T-DAB+ digital terrestrial broadcasting networks in the whole territory of Slovenia. RTV Slovenia, which was the only bidder in the tender, has now become the operator of two more digital radio networks. RTV Slovenija already operates Slovenia's first DAB+ digital radio network, the R1 multiplex, which is available throughout Slovenia, a second network, or the R2 multiplex, which is divided into east and west, and the R3 network, which is available in central Slovenia, Akos said. The company will have to start operating the R4 multiplex within 199 days and the R5 multiplex within 249 days after the decisions have been notified.

RTI cz and TELEKO DAB muxes for Prague from new mast
13.08.2024 - Czechia Czechia
Telecomms companies RTI cz and Teleko digital are distributing their multiplexes for the Czech capital from a new transmitting antenna. This is according to information available to the Digital Radio portal. The new mast is located on the roof of the Spartakiada stadium in Strahov. The switchover of the original to the new DAB+ transmitter took place on Monday afternoon, the short outage lasted only a few minutes. The connection to the large antenna at the Strahov stadium is mainly a preparation of the first-named company for the launch of the Strahov transmitter on channel 8D - the existing licence for channel 5A expires at the end of the year.

Aldena acquires Delta Meccanica
12.08.2024 - ALDENA WorldDAB Member - Italy Italy
Milan-based antenna technology manufacturer Aldena has marked its 45th year in business with the acquisition of Delta Meccanica, a manufacturer of RF coaxial passive components. Aldena says this milestone anniversary and acquisition highlight the company’s commitment to future growth and expansion. The acquisition of Delta Meccanica follows years of collaboration and represents a step in Aldena’s growth strategy. Delta Meccanica has a reputation in filters and combiners engineering solutions. By integrating Delta Meccanica into its operations, Aldena diversifies its portfolio and enhances its capability to offer comprehensive solutions.

Sky News extends reach with 'Sky News Radio' now on DAB+ in Sydney, Melbourne and Brisbane
12.08.2024 - Australia Australia
Sky News Australia extends the reach of Sky News Radio, bringing the live audio stream of its Sky News television channel to listeners of DAB digital radio in metropolitan markets Sydney, Melbourne and Brisbane. Tim Love, Sky News Australia Head of Digital, said: “This year we’ve continued to grow our multiplatform offering and our launch into digital radio is another fantastic avenue that enables our network to extend the reach of our news, opinion and documentary programming to more Australians.” Sky News Australia is Australia’s premier multiplatform news network and leading provider of 24-hour television news and opinion content reaching more than 11 million Australians each month. It is the number one most engaging digital news brand in the country.

Indonesian Minister of Communication and Information encourages LPP RRI to implement digitalisation
09.08.2024 - RRI (Radio Republik Indonesia) WorldDAB Member - Indonesia Indonesia
Advances in digital technology are shifting the behaviour of audiences in listening to radio broadcasts. Responding to the dynamics of disruption due to technology, Minister of Communication and Information Budi Arie Setiadi encouraged Public Broadcasting Institution (LPP) Radio Republik Indonesia (RRI) to implement digitalisation. "Disruption to the broadcasting industry presents a challenge for radio people to maintain their existence. This gives urgency to the radio broadcasting industry to adapt to technological developments," he said in a Public Discussion on "Challenges and Opportunities of Radio Broadcasting Digitalisation" organised by LPP RRI in Central Jakarta, on 1 August. He notes a key step was optimising the development of the digital radio ecosystem through the utilisation of LPP RRI's infrastructure. This includes the adoption of the DAB+ technology standard.

DAB+ set for strong autumn push, now 18% of listeners in Czechia
08.08.2024 - Czechia Czechia
The share of digital radio listeners is slowly approaching twenty percent. Eighteen percent of listeners used the DAB+ platform in the first half of this year. This was shown by the results of Radioprojekt, an official measurement of the popularity of Czech radio stations, presented on 7 August. The development of new radio multiplexes with commercial radio, the expansion of coverage and especially activities related to the development of DAB+ will be key to strengthening this digital platform on the Czech market. Currently, 18 per cent of listeners who said that their reception is provided by a conventional receiver or car radio use digital terrestrial radio. (Up from 17% last year, and 11% in 2021.)
